The Power Of Social Emotional Learning Activities

Social emotional learning (SEL) activities play a crucial role in helping individuals develop important skills that are essential for success in both personal and professional life. From enhancing communication skills to fostering empathy and promoting self-awareness, these activities aim to cultivate social and emotional competence in individuals of all ages.

One of the key benefits of engaging in social emotional learning activities is the ability to improve one’s ability to understand and manage emotions. By participating in activities that encourage self-reflection and self-awareness, individuals can develop a deeper understanding of their own emotions and learn how to effectively regulate them. This can lead to better emotional intelligence, which is a valuable skill in building healthy relationships and navigating various social situations.

Furthermore, social emotional learning activities can also help individuals develop empathy and build strong interpersonal relationships. By engaging in activities that promote empathy and perspective-taking, individuals can learn to see things from others’ points of view and develop a greater sense of compassion and understanding towards others. This can lead to improved communication skills, conflict resolution abilities, and overall stronger relationships with others.

In addition, social emotional learning activities can also aid in developing important life skills such as decision-making, problem-solving, and goal-setting. By participating in activities that require critical thinking and decision-making skills, individuals can learn how to effectively evaluate options, make informed decisions, and solve problems in a constructive manner. This can lead to greater resilience and adaptability in the face of challenges, as well as increased motivation and goal attainment.

One of the key aspects of social emotional learning activities is their ability to promote a positive school climate and improve academic outcomes. Research has shown that students who participate in social emotional learning activities are more engaged in the learning process, have better attendance rates, and achieve higher academic performance. This is because these activities help students develop important skills such as self-regulation, perseverance, and collaboration, which are essential for academic success.

Moreover, social emotional learning activities can also help individuals manage stress and build resilience in the face of adversity. By engaging in activities that promote mindfulness, relaxation, and positive coping strategies, individuals can learn how to effectively cope with stress and build resilience to overcome challenges. This can lead to improved mental health and well-being, as well as a greater sense of overall satisfaction and fulfillment in life.
